An item that is essential to accessorize all outfits is the wrist watch. Watches have made a big comeback in the past few seasons and they have shown serious staying power. The reason behind the popularity of this old-fashioned, oversized, menswear-inspired piece is because a watch instantly spruces up an outfit. Wrist watches provide mature arm candy in any hardware you want – silver, gold, ceramic or leather strap. Slip on a watch and you instantly professionalize your work attire, glam up a night look or add the only necessary piece of jewelry you need for a casual day. Holler for a Collar
Yes, Honey Boo-Boo Child’s this stylish fall trend can be found around the neck of only the most fashionable. Collar necklaces are the new statement pieces and they are being spotted everywhere! Kim K, Jessica Alba and Kelly Osbourne have donned this neck accessory and you can pull off the look as well. Find a great silver or gold collar necklace and keep the rest of your accessories above the neck very simple; the collar necklace demands all the attention so don’t wear any competing pieces. Black & Bright!
It’s no mystery that black is a favored color when it comes to clothing. Black goes with everything. Black is flattering and slimming. Black is simple and conventional, yet elegant and timeless. But who’s to say our beloved go-to color doesn’t need a little brightening up sometimes. One of my favorite trends to appear in the fashion world is the bright-with-black trend.
